Setting the iPod Assignment

It is possible to assign the Control Dock for iPod’s (ASD-1R, sold separately) audio and video signals to any input terminals on the AVR- 587 and play them.

Setting the EXT. IN Subwoofer Level

Sets the playback level of the analog signal that was input to the EXT. IN subwoofer terminal.

Setting the Auto Preset Memory

Up to 56 FM stations can be preset automatically ( page 36).
